Output 7d84ea531884598de0effa7aa030d75680d4d6b2ada76d266166f7987d25650e:0

value
774329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f81c371efeea3a292572a252bdb2a3553a1f15c OP_EQUAL
address
38wQkpbZ6a9kAA2grRYHvrudbTCBW2LKeG
transaction
7d84ea531884598de0effa7aa030d75680d4d6b2ada76d266166f7987d25650e
confirmations
174178
spent
true